§ 7104. Extraterritorial jurisdiction; group long-term care insurance. No group long-term care insurance coverage may be offered to a resident of this State under a group policy issued in another state to a group described in § 7103(4) of this title, unless this State or another state having statutory and regulatory long-term care insurance requirements substantially similar to those adopted in this State has made a determination that such requirements have been met.67 Del. Laws, c. 102, § 1; 68 Del. Laws, c. 160, § 3;
